We first showed you a video of the upcoming fall Xbox 360 dashboard update back in August. A new video leaked recently that better reflects what the final update will look like. The only catch: the dashboard depicted is set to French instead of English. Brave the language barrier and you’ll see how various sections of the dashboard like the Games Marketplace actually look, as well as Kinect controls.

The fall 2011 dashboard update is rumored to debut on November 15. The update’s design philosophy should be immediately apparent to Windows Phone users: it’s Metro. I’m excited about the clean, streamlined appearance. What about you guys? Do you think Metro will work well as a console interface?

Source: NeoGAF forums via Kotaku